Lecture 10 | Further Selected Theological Themes in Christology and Jesus and the Spirit.

In this lecture we consider more of the main Christological themes found in the four Gospels. Matthew particularly presents for his Jewish readers Jesus as the Second Moses, who by His death for us accomplishes a new and greater exodos or redemption, setting out for us the true meaning of the law in the Sermon on the Mount and by the shedding of His own blood brings us into a new covenant relationship with God. As Logos He transcends all Hellenistic or Jewish perceptions of this concept and is affirmed by John as the Logos who exists in the beginning, exists with God, in the very nature of God. He is agent of creation, the source of all life and light, who Himself being God, reveals the unseen God. Jesus is the Lamb of God, who fulfils all that Passover looked forward to and is the shepherd of His people who lays down His life for them. In all His ministry, He is enabled, guided by the Spirit of God.
